A three-property portfolio in Trail, B.C., was picked up by Highliving Properties for $14.9m in an off-market deal, Green Street News can reveal.
The sale took place in late February at a 5.9% cap rate for the properties that add up to more than 7 acres. Trail Apartment Holdings was the seller.
Avison Young brokered the deal for the portfolio, consisting of 119 units. The price works out to about $125,000/ unit.
The properties include Bella Vista at 1976 Seventh Avenue, Francesco’s Estates at 3550 Highway Drive and Ermelinda Estates at 3188 Highway Drive.
Bella Vista is a 48-unit townhouse rental on a 3.5-acre parcel, Francesco’s Estates has 30 units on 2 acres of land and Ermelinda Estates consists of 41 units on 2 acres of land.
Highliving Properties is a Metro Vancouver-based residential rental company with several assets throughout B.C. and Alberta.
This latest portfolio purchase brings its presence in Trail to four properties.
Trail is a city of about 9,000 in B.C.’s Kootenay region about 390 km east of Vancouver.
